Jammu division to witness `heavy to very heavy’ rains over the next three days

Jammu: From Monday onward, Jammu division will witness moderate to heavy rains over the next three days as the lower and middle level tropospheric winds from Northern Arabian sea are most likely to interact with Easterly winds from Bay of Bengal from July 18-21, said meteorological department officials.

The system is most likely to cause widespread heavy to very heavy rains, thunder with lightening at most places of Jammu mainly in Pir Panjal range and plains of Jammu division from July 19-21.

There will, however, be moderate to heavy rain and thunder with lightening at many places in Kashmir during the period.

This is likely to cause moderate to high risk of flash floods, temporary disruption of surface transport mainly on Jammu-Srinagar, Srinagar-Leh, Doda-Kishtwar and Mughal Road during the period, apart from water logging and flash floods in low lying areas, and suspension of agriculture and horticulture operations, they added.
